Basoli Malli is a Rural village located in Dhoomakot, Pauri-garhwal, Uttarakhand.
The total population of Basoli Malli is 75.
Basoli Malli village comprises 21 households.
The literacy rate in Basoli Malli is 77.5%. Among the literate population of 55, there are 30 literate males and 25 literate females.
In Basoli Malli, there are 35 males and 40 females, with a sex ratio of 1143 females per 1000 males.
There are 4 children (5.3% of population), comprising 3 boys and 1 girls.
The total number of workers in Basoli Malli is 27, with 24 main workers and 3 marginal workers.
In Basoli Malli, there are 4 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(3 males, 1 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Basoli Malli is located in Uttarakhand state, Pauri-garhwal district, and falls under Dhoomakot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 47102 and LGD code is 47102.
